Mysql
 sql >> Datenbank >  >> RDS >> Mysql

Wie implementiert man Hintergrund-/asynchrones Write-Behind-Caching in PHP?

mysql_query('INSERT INTO tableName VALUES(...),(...),(...),(...)')

Die oben angegebene Abfrageanweisung ist besser. Aber wir haben eine andere Lösung, um die Leistung der Insert-Anweisung zu verbessern.
Folgen Sie den folgenden Schritten..
1. Sie erstellen einfach eine CSV-Datei (Comma Separated Delimited File) oder eine einfache TXT-Datei und schreiben alle Daten, die Sie einfügen möchten, mithilfe eines Dateischreibmechanismus (wie der FileOutputStream-Klasse in Java).
2. Verwenden Sie diesen Befehl

LOAD DATA INFILE 'data.txt' INTO TABLE table2
  FIELDS TERMINATED BY '\t';

3 Wenn Sie sich über diesen Befehl nicht im Klaren sind, folgen Sie dem Link